在 C# 中扫描二维码。

概述

二维码在各个行业中对于高效数据传输至关重要,包括物流和营销。在本文中,我们将探讨如何使用 $99 Aspose.BarCode for .NET 插件 程序化地 在 C# 中扫描二维码——这是一个旨在无缝处理 2D 条形码并具备强大 ASP.NET 二维码扫描器 功能的强大库。

主要特性

  • 广泛的格式支持:使用 C# 中的条形码读取应用程序 解码多种格式,包括二维码、数据矩阵、阿兹特克码等。
  • 灵活的输入选项:通过多功能的 C# 条形码读取器 从图像、流或网络摄像头获取条形码。
  • 强大的识别能力:有效处理旋转、失真或噪声的二维码图像,对于任何 C# 条形码读取代码 实现至关重要。
  • 经济高效的解决方案:非常适合寻求可靠的 C# 条形码扫描 API 的企业开发者和爱好者。

本指南包括:


C# QR 码扫描 API

Aspose.BarCode for .NET 库是一个全面的解决方案,用于程序化读取二维码和各种其他条形码格式。它被认为是 最佳 C# 二维码读取库,并且作为需要 .NET 二维码读取 API 项目的优秀 开源替代方案。您可以利用它进行:

  • WPF 应用程序:无缝集成到桌面应用程序中。
  • ASP.NET 项目:通过 ASP.NET C# 中的二维码扫描器 启用服务器端条形码扫描。
  • 跨平台应用:完全支持 .NET Core.NET MAUI

安装

要开始使用,请通过 NuGet 安装 API:

PM> Install-Package Aspose.BarCode

如果您在寻找 经济高效的 C# 二维码扫描器,您可以考虑其他库,但这个库因其功能而闻名。您还可以 下载 DLL 进行手动集成


在 C# 中扫描二维码

要从图像文件中扫描二维码,请按照以下步骤操作:

  1. 使用 DecodeType.QR 参数初始化 BarCodeReader 类。
  2. 使用 ReadBarCodes() 方法处理条形码。
  3. 从结果中提取条形码文本和类型等数据。

以下是演示 如何在 C# 中扫描二维码 的代码示例:


从流中扫描二维码

要从流中读取二维码,请执行以下步骤:

  1. 创建 BarCodeReader 类的实例,指定 DecodeType.QR
  2. 使用 ReadBarCodes() 方法扫描流。
  3. 从结果中检索解码的数据。

下面的代码示例演示 如何从流中扫描二维码


二维码扫描的应用

主要用例

  • 零售:通过 C# 条形码读取库 简化库存管理和销售点系统。
  • 医疗:使用 C# 条形码读取开源 解决方案增强患者识别和药品跟踪。
  • 物流:通过 C# 条形码解码器 优化基于二维码的标签的发货跟踪。
  • 营销:创建带有嵌入二维码链接的互动活动。

免费许可证和资源

获取免费临时许可证

通过请求 免费临时许可证 解锁 API 的全部功能,享受对所有功能的无限制访问。

学习资源


结论

在本教程中,我们演示了如何:

  • 使用 C# 二维码读取器 程序化地从文件或流中扫描二维码。
  • 利用 Aspose.BarCode 的高级功能进行强大而高效的二维码解码,包括 C# 从图像读取二维码C# 从 PDF 读取二维码 的选项。

凭借其高性能和经济性,$99 Aspose.BarCode Reader 插件 是寻求可靠 .NET 6 二维码读取器 的开发者的绝佳选择。请在 文档 中探索更多功能或在我们的 支持论坛 中寻求帮助。